First, open your preferred web browser. Type the specific web address provided by your school or district. This usually looks like “aspen.yourschooldistrict.org” or something similar. Bookmark this page to save time later.
You will see two main fields: one for your username and one for your password. Your username is often your student ID number or a district-assigned email. Your password is case-sensitive, so check your Caps Lock key before clicking “Log In.”

If you are a first-time user, your initial password might be a default one like “Welcome1” or your birthdate. The system will prompt you to change it after your first successful sign-in. Follow the on-screen instructions to create a strong, memorable password.
Common Login Issues
Sometimes you might see an error message. The most common problem is a forgotten password. Look for the “Forgot Password” link on the login page. Click it and follow the steps to reset your credentials via your registered email or phone number.
- Check your internet connection if the page doesn’t load.
- Clear your browser cache and cookies if the site behaves oddly.
- Try a different browser like Chrome or Firefox if issues persist.
- Contact your school’s IT support if you still cannot access your account.

Mobile Access Tips
You can also use Aspen on your phone or tablet. The mobile site is responsive and works well on smaller screens. Some schools offer a dedicated app, but the browser version is usually more reliable. Bookmark the login page on your mobile device for quick access.
If you share a computer, always log out when you are finished. Look for the “Log Out” button in the top right corner of the screen. This prevents others from accessing your personal information.
